Pular para o conteúdo principal

Entity Remover

O conceito desse plugin é remover certas entidades de mapas específicos, ou de todos.Certo, mas, o que são entidades ? Entidades são objetos que executam algum comportamento dentro do jogo, como por exemplo, portas, vidros, sons de ambiente ou mesmo os próprios jogadores.

Como usar:

O plugin oferece suporte à configurações externas, o que significa que ele carregará a lista de entidades definida por você à partir de um arquivo. Por padrão, nomeei esse arquivo como
"cstrike_entity_remover.ini" e deve estar dentro da pasta "configs".

Para remover entidades de todos os mapas, dentro de "TodosMapas", defina sua lista. Exemplo:
TodosMapas
{
    func_buyzone
}

Para remover entidades em mapas específicos, especifique o mapa e adicione os nomes das entidades. Exemplo:
cs_assault
{
    func_door
    func_door_rotating
}

de_dust2
{
    func_breakable
}

Remoção das entidades func_door (esquerda) e func_door_rotating (direita) no mapa cs_assault.

Changelog:
Versão 0.0.1 - Lançamento.
Versão 0.0.2 - Código otimizado ao uso de TrieSet|Exists.

┏ Downloads:
cstrike_entity_remover.ini
cstrike_EntityRemover.sma
cstrike_EntityRemover.amxx
(versão de compilação: AMX Mod X Compiler 1.8.3-dev+5110)

# Link do projeto no GitHub #

Comentários